你查询的IP:[159.226.52.0]  地理位置:中国–北京–北京科学院网

最新查询122.192.101.114 116.128.231.26 123.196.221.73 117.128.244.14 121.201.140.107 118.80.183.195 166.111.139.20 59.155.231.29 222.176.169.231 159.226.52.0 219.72.181.61 203.100.80.188 116.16.58.1 210.51.235.59 202.38.164.195 203.161.192.66 116.69.146.63 202.168.160.195 116.1.89.45 124.108.8.87 203.91.96.9 123.108.128.69 123.8.36.208 121.255.192.134 124.220.191.32 117.106.167.182 202.14.238.43 159.226.47.170 58.32.214.188 118.88.32.76 60.247.122.118